Introduction: Investing in sustainable and green initiatives involves allocating capital to businesses and projects that prioritize environmental and social responsibility. Beyond financial returns, these investments aim to create a positive impact on the planet and society. Table: Key Aspects of Investment in Sustainable and Green Initiatives Aspect Description 1. Sustainable Investing Sustainable investments consider environmental, social, and governance (ESG) factors alongside financial returns. 2. Green Investments Green investments focus on projects and companies that contribute to environmental conservation and sustainability, such as renewable energy or clean technology. 3. Impact Investing Impact investing goes a step further, aiming to generate measurable, positive social or environmental impacts in addition to financial returns. 4. Types of Investments Options include green bonds, ESG-focused mutual funds or ETFs, impact-driven startups, and renewable energy projects. 5. Risk and Return While sustainable investments can offer competitive financial returns, they may carry unique risks tied to ESG factors or the impact they aim to create. 6. Diversification Building a diversified portfolio of sustainable investments can help spread risk while supporting a range of causes. 7. Aligning Values Sustainable investments allow investors to align their portfolios with their personal values and beliefs, fostering a sense of purpose. 8. Research and Due Diligence Assess the credibility and transparency of sustainable investments, considering factors like the issuer's track record and alignment with your values. 9. Regulatory Environment Stay informed about evolving regulations and standards related to sustainable investing, which can impact investment decisions. 10. Measuring Impact Impact investors often use metrics and reporting to track the positive changes generated by their investments. Facts and Analysis: Sustainable and green investments have gained popularity as investors seek to address global challenges like climate change, social inequality, and resource depletion. Companies with strong ESG performance are often better positioned for long-term growth and resilience. Impact investing demonstrates the potential for both financial returns and meaningful contributions to societal and environmental goals. Conclusion: Investing in sustainable and green initiatives allows investors to make a positive impact on the world while potentially achieving financial returns. These investments align with personal values and contribute to the broader global transition toward a more sustainable and equitable future. Careful research, due diligence, and a diversified approach can help investors navigate the growing landscape of sustainable and green investment opportunities.
